Students Participate in Habitat Build

Thomas Jefferson Classical Academy's class of 2017 took part in​ ​the​ annual ​Senior​Volunteer Day on Wednesday. In an effort to engage with the larger community​,​ the students chose different organizations and volunteered several hours of their time in various capacities.

​ Michael ​Fair, the 12th grade Government and Economics teacher, led a group of twelve students to ​a​ Habitat for Humanity building site in Spindale. The​ students​ installed laminate flooring in several rooms and painted a significant amount of trim and molding in two separate home sites. This was their second year working with Habitat for Humanity and the students and Mr. Fair say they look forward to continuing their relationship with the Habitat team​ in the future​.

​ Participating students at Habitat were: Kosta Lee Habridge, Nick Longerbeam, Emily Alred, Erin Tevis, Clayton Alexander, Hayden Alexander, Abbery Friday, Peter Oliphant, Clay Fowler, Paris Lane, Ali Huston and Alex Harrelson.
